The key fobs of a Subaru vehicle are a little different than some others. They use a slightly different chip and algorithm. This flaw enabled hackers to duplicate Subaru fobs. The problem was spotted by Tom Wimmenhove, an electronics designer who discovered a simple hack that can be used to copy Subaru fobs that have keys and gain access to cars. The hack works by recording and analyzing the roll-by-roll lock-and-unlock codes sent by the fobs. The result is a set of predictable or sequential codes which can be duplicated on the Raspberry Pi for around $25.
Transponder keys
Many vehicles that are equipped with a transponder chip come with an anti-theft option. Transponder keys (also called "chip keys") are equipped with an embedded microchip that transmits a signal to the receiver, which is located in the car. The receiver is looking for the specific signal and only allows the key to open your vehicle. This is a great method to stop thieves from stealing your vehicle's hot-wire.
The engine control unit (ECU) when the key is inserted into the ignition, transmits an information to a transponder chip. The chip responds by sending a unique digital serial code that matches the ECU database. This causes the car to believe that the key is authentic and allows it to start.
